Output ddd34e6c2b9947fb0a90b8d6ba656d6839a90a37caba0df3932929342352f7ed:2

value
2611327515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e799b2151b591a7efebf153ea05bacfd3e9bd8e OP_EQUAL
address
37PMVmY2NzTK3zVQLwVXsyfV4QPEJWYejG
transaction
ddd34e6c2b9947fb0a90b8d6ba656d6839a90a37caba0df3932929342352f7ed
confirmations
541904
spent
true